Zaldy Co Bids Farewell To Appropriations Chairmanship, Cites Health As Priority
Photo credit: Rep Zaldy Co
Ako Bicol Partylist Rep. Zaldy Co announced his decision to step down as the Chairman of the House Committee on Appropriations, a role he has held with distinction for the past three years. Co’s announcement, shared on January 13, 2025, highlights the toll the demanding position has taken on his health, prompting him to seek necessary medical attention.

Expressing deep gratitude, Co thanked the majority in Congress for their support, acknowledging the immense honor it has been to steer the nation’s budget. His leadership saw the successful implementation of key programs like the Ayuda sa Kapos ang Kita Program, which provided much-needed financial relief to families with insufficient income. Co’s tenure also focused on securing funding for crucial initiatives in health, housing, and food security, aligning with the President's eight-point economic agenda.

In a social media post, Co reflected on his dedication to the role: “My decision to step down was not an easy one. I have poured my heart and soul into ensuring each centavo of the people's money was put to good use. The stresses and long hours have taken their toll, and I must now prioritize my health to better serve the people in the years ahead. Thank you, Speaker Martin, and my colleagues in Congress! Padagos!”

Co’s departure marks the end of a significant chapter in his political career, but he remains committed to serving his constituents in other capacities.
